Tata to showcase sedan concept at 2018 Geneva Motor Show

Tata Motors will be showcasing a new concept at the 2018 Geneva Motor Show in March. It will reportedly preview an upcoming sedan that is likely to compete with the Honda City and Hyundai Verna in the Indian market.

Tata Motors has released a teaser image of the upcoming concept that partially reveals its front fascia. The styling is expected to be based on Tata's Impact 2.0 design language and will feature slim LED headlights and LED DRLs. According to a media report, it will be based on the Advanced Modular Platform (AMP) and will have a coupe-like roofline.

Media reports suggest that the production-spec car could be offered with retuned versions of the Revotron petrol and Revotorq diesel engines paired with a manual gearbox. Tata might also offer a dual-clutch transmission on its new sedan. It is rumoured that a sportier JTP version and a hybrid could also be on the cards.

That said, according to the report, the Tata Motors board hasn't given its go-ahead for the project which is estimated to cost around Rs. 400 crore.
